
Contributed to the splitwave-br/design-system-splitwave repository by developing two reusable UI components—a Radio Button and a Conversation Icon—focused on improving consistency and maintainability across applications. Leveraged React, TypeScript, and SCSS to implement the Radio Button with variant support and SCSS module-based theming, while introducing CSS variable-driven spacing and standardized label font sizes for uniformity. Enhanced the design system further by adding a Conversation Icon component, registering it for cross-app use, and standardizing SVG attribute naming conventions. These efforts streamlined cross-team UI development, accelerated icon adoption, and reduced maintenance overhead, demonstrating a methodical approach to scalable front-end architecture.
September 2025 performance summary focusing on design-system enhancements and UI consistency. Delivered the Conversation Icon Component in the design system and registered it for cross-application usage. Implemented internal updates to standardize SVG attribute naming (strokeWidth, camelCase) to improve consistency and future maintainability. No major bugs were fixed this month; efforts centered on design-system polish and enabling reuse. Key business value includes faster icon adoption, consistent UI across products, and reduced maintenance costs. Key technologies demonstrated include Design System, React/TSX, SVG, and commit-driven development with cross-team collaboration.
September 2025 performance summary focusing on design-system enhancements and UI consistency. Delivered the Conversation Icon Component in the design system and registered it for cross-application usage. Implemented internal updates to standardize SVG attribute naming (strokeWidth, camelCase) to improve consistency and future maintainability. No major bugs were fixed this month; efforts centered on design-system polish and enabling reuse. Key business value includes faster icon adoption, consistent UI across products, and reduced maintenance costs. Key technologies demonstrated include Design System, React/TSX, SVG, and commit-driven development with cross-team collaboration.
June 2025 monthly highlights for splitwave-br/design-system-splitwave focused on delivering a robust, reusable UI control and tightening spacing consistency across the design system. Key outcomes: a new Radio Button Component with support for selection, variants (default and success), and SCSS module-based theming; spacing improvements that replace fixed pixel gaps with CSS variables; and label font-size adjustments to improve consistency and maintainability. These changes standardize form controls, accelerate cross-app UI development, and enhance theming flexibility across products.
June 2025 monthly highlights for splitwave-br/design-system-splitwave focused on delivering a robust, reusable UI control and tightening spacing consistency across the design system. Key outcomes: a new Radio Button Component with support for selection, variants (default and success), and SCSS module-based theming; spacing improvements that replace fixed pixel gaps with CSS variables; and label font-size adjustments to improve consistency and maintainability. These changes standardize form controls, accelerate cross-app UI development, and enhance theming flexibility across products.

Overview of all repositories you've contributed to across your timeline